Aug 31, 2023 · The Tokyo Stock Exchange began in 1878 as a market for government bonds issued to former samurai. Trading was active until it shut down in 1947 in the wake of Japan’s defeat in World War II. It reopened in 1949 and has operated continuously since. Dec 7, 2022 · 2. Purchase Japanese stocks indirectly by buying American Depository Receipts (ADRs). ADRs are securities that represent shares of a foreign company. They are traded on American exchanges and can be easier to purchase than directly buying a foreign stock. 3. Purchase Japanese mutual funds or exchange-traded funds (ETFs). Nov 26, 2023 · The Nikkei 225 index is a major stock market in Japan. The index consists of the 225 largest blue-chip companies listed on the Tokyo stock Exchange. These companies are highly valued and have a reputation for high performance. It is often compared to the Dow Jones Industrial Average in the United States.
